Pocket-Lint: Shellshock 2: Blood Trails Review

On the plus side, the game won't last you more than half a dozen hours to finish off. And with no multiplayer offerings, there's no reason to not bury this one in the back garden and hope the dog doesn't bring it back to the surface.

There's no real reason for Shellshock 2 to exist. No one enjoyed the first game, and the genre has so many quality titles recently released that Shellshock 2 has absolutely no audience.

Leave well alone.
2 / 10
